spa  (spä)
n.
1. A resort providing therapeutic baths.
2. A resort area having mineral springs.
3. A fashionable hotel or resort.
4. A health spa.
5. A tub for relaxation or invigoration, usually including a device for raising whirlpools in the water.
6. Eastern New England See soda fountain.

[After Spa, a resort town of eastern Belgium.]
Regional Note: The word spa, taken from the name of the famous mineral springs in Spa, Belgium, has become a common noun denoting any place with a medicinal or mineral spring. Less well known is its Eastern New England sense, "soda fountain," probably an allusion to the carbonated or "mineral" water that is a staple ingredient of many soda fountain concoctions.

spa
Noun
a mineral-water spring or a resort where such a spring is found [after Spa, a watering place in Belgium]
